Post CPAP PRO MASK 
Has anyone tried the new CPAP PRO'S?  I have been using the mirage swift since last December and now I am having problems keeping the blue head gear from sliding up the back of my head.  I have tried loosing the straps but that just causes the pillows to come off my nose and tightening the straps make it slide up even faster....more like when I move my head off my pillow just so slightly.  Any suggestions on any of the masks.  I have tried the breeze but I can not seem to keep it from coming apart.

Ginger,
  Strappy headgear slides around on my slippery hair.  My hair is medium length. After securing the headgear in place, I run my finger under the headgear straps, lifting my hair up, and out over it, then my hair acutally helps keep the straps down.  I even do this with a hunk of hair on each side of my head when wearing the breeze.  This won't work for those with very short hair, but if your hair is medium or long, put it to work for you.
  I haven't seen many good reviews of the cpap-pro.  If you have bruxism, or mouth breathing, that is a problem, and even if you don't, many people find having a mouth peice causes drooling, and TMJ.  You've got a couple of good masks, swift and breeze, try the hair trick bfore spending more money.
